Output f8923cad8814b1e874a05076aa343d63b8d1b38d7e470b34716a06cf466f05e1:0

value
1027667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82d2f86b24b541fb2e2c00391ac1595e27174f5b OP_EQUAL
address
3DckVxhAAaf37smWAG38GRKvJwAnYNhHwW
transaction
f8923cad8814b1e874a05076aa343d63b8d1b38d7e470b34716a06cf466f05e1
confirmations
308329
spent
true